General Information

The power train electronic control module (ECM) uses the main display module on the Caterpillar Monitoring System for showing diagnostic information to service personnel. Diagnostic information concerning the power train ECM is sent via the Cat Data Link to the Caterpillar Monitoring System. Service personnel must be familiar with the Caterpillar Monitoring System in order to troubleshoot the power train ECM.

The Caterpillar Monitoring System has different modes for troubleshooting and calibration. The service personnel need to be able to place the Caterpillar Monitoring System in the correct mode of operation.

The calibration mode for the lockup clutch is -5-. Use the following steps to access the calibration mode for the torque converter lockup clutch.

  1. Connect the 4C-8195 Control Service Tool to the four-pin connector.

    Note: The service mode connector is located at the bottom of the dash near the brake pedal. In order to use the service mode connector, reach underneath the dash and pull out the service mode connector.

  1. Turn the key start switch and the battery disconnect switch to the ON position.

  1. Depress the "MODE" switch on the 4C-8195 Control Service Tool. The Caterpillar Monitoring System will scroll to different display modes in the display area while the "MODE" switch is depressed. The display mode -5- is the calibration mode for the torque converter lockup clutch that is used by the power train ECM. The "MODE" switch should be held until -5- is shown in the display area on the Caterpillar Monitoring System.

Calibrating the Torque Converter Lockup Clutch

The torque converter lockup clutch will need to be calibrated, when the CID 0709 FMI 13 diagnostic code is displayed on the Caterpillar Monitoring System.

The CID 0709 FMI 13 diagnostic code is recorded, when one of these conditions occur.

  • The power train electronic control module (ECM) determines that the solenoid modulating valve (torque converter lockup clutch) needs to be calibrated.

  • The power train electronic control module (ECM) has been replaced.

  • New software is flashed to the power train electronic control module (ECM).

The following procedure is used to calibrate the pressure for the modulating valve (torque converter lockup clutch).

Procedure

------ WARNING! ------

Sudden movement of the machine or release of oil under pressure can cause injury to persons on or near the machine.

To prevent possible injury, perform the procedure that follows before testing and adjusting the power train.

----------------------

Before you start the test procedure, complete the following procedure:

  • Machine Preparation for Troubleshooting

Reference: For additional information on preparing the machine for troubleshooting, refer to Testing and Adjusting, "Machine Preparation for Troubleshooting" for the machine that is being serviced.

  1. Move the transmission direction control switch to the NEUTRAL position.

  1. Engage the parking brake.

  1. Connect 4C-8195 Control Service Tool to the service mode connector (four pin). The service mode connector is located at the bottom of the dash near the brake pedal.



    Illustration 1g00715382

    Right Front Side of the Machine




    Illustration 2g00703470

    Location of Modulating Valve (Torque Converter Lockup Clutch)

    (1) Modulating valve (torque converter lockup clutch). (2) Pressure tap.

    The right rear side cover for the engine compartment has been removed for clarity.

  1. Open the top panel and remove the bottom panel in order to gain access to modulating valve (1) .

  1. Connect a 4135 kPa (600 psi) pressure gauge to pressure tap (2) on modulating valve (1).

    Note: The modulating valve (torque converter lockup clutch) is mounted on the right side of the torque converter housing at the rear of the engine compartment.

  1. Start the engine.

  1. Press and hold the "MODE" switch on the control service tool down until the display area on the Caterpillar Monitoring System displays -5-. (mode 5 is the torque converter lockup clutch calibration mode)

  1. In the calibration mode, the Caterpillar Monitoring System will display the recommended pressure kPa for the torque converter lockup clutch or an error code. If the pressure is displayed, go to Step 9. If an error code is displayed on the Caterpillar Monitoring System, you should correct the error. Then go to Step 9. The error codes are listed in the Table 1 below.

    Table 1
    Error Codes    
    Error No.     Description    
    E01     The transmission direction control switch is not in the NEUTRAL position.    
    E02     The transmission output speed is not zero (0 RPM).    
    E03     The parking brake is not engaged.    
    E04     The lockup clutch solenoid has an active fault.    

  1. Place the transmission direction control switch in the FORWARD position. The Caterpillar Monitoring System will display a number. There is a limited range for adjusting the value of this number. This number is related to the amount of current that is supplied to the lockup clutch solenoid. The current is proportional to the pressure that is displayed on the gauge that is connected to the pressure tap on modulating valve (1) .

  1. Use the "CLEAR" switch on the control service tool to regulate the current. Press the switch upward in order to increase the current (+) to the solenoid. The number in the display area will increase. Press the switch downward in order to decrease the current (-) to the solenoid. The number in the display area will decrease. Increasing the current will increase the pressure. Decreasing the current will decrease the pressure.

  1. Adjust the pressure, until the pressure on the gauge matches the recommended pressure from Step 8.

  1. The calibration is now complete. Move the transmission direction control switch to the NEUTRAL position.

  1. Press and hold "MODE" switch down until the display area on the Caterpillar Monitoring System displays the hour meter.

  1. Stop the engine.

  1. Disconnect the control service tool and the pressure gauge.

  1. Install the engine panels.
